How PlainAttorney Search Works

The search tool on this page lets you query the full PlainAttorney dataset by name, location, identifier, or any supported field. We index every record at ingestion time so typical queries return in well under a second, even on large result sets. Matching is tolerant of partial input and common misspellings — you can type a last name, a city, a bar or license number, or any fragment of a record title. If you get no results, try broadening the query or using a shorter prefix.

Every search queries our read-only mirror of the New York Office of Court Administration attorney-registration dataset — 429,620 records as of the Q1 2026 refresh. We update the mirror each quarter from the state's NY Open Data publication (see the methodology page for the exact source freshness window) and we do not modify the underlying records, only normalize formatting (title case, trimmed whitespace, standardized state codes) so that search results are consistent across records with different upstream spellings. Results link directly to the full record page, where you will see the complete regulated data plus plain-language explainers that describe what each field means.
